Iodine effect on my Thyroid for purifying water.

by TobyH, Apr 21, 2007 12:00AM
Hi,

I have Hypopituitarism, which means my Thyroid gland is not getting the right hormones transmitted to it from the pituitary gland to produce the correct quantitiy of T's.

I am very much into outdoor activities and because of this sometimes I may need to purify water to drink. There are a number of ways of doing this. One is to use Iodine. I am aware that this can affect the Thyroid gland for people who have problems with this, but I would like to get some information as to how this could effect me with my specific condition.

Any help would be greatly appreciated!

Toby

by Mark Lupo, M.D., Apr 23, 2007 12:00AM
If you are on thyroxine and the T4/T3 are stable (as you know, TSH is not reliable in this setting), then iodine to purify the water should not cause a problem.
